~drizzle-trunk/drizzle/development

« back to all changes in this revision

Viewing changes to tests/t/default.test

  • Committer: Brian Aker
  • Date: 2010-05-26 21:49:18 UTC
  • mto: This revision was merged to the branch mainline in revision 1568.
  • Revision ID: brian@gaz-20100526214918-8kdibq48e9lnyr6t
This fixes bug 586009, increases the size of the log files so that the UNION
test doesn't hit Innodb's default limit. Increases the size of the initial
Innodb data file, and fixes one case where an empty string on error was
causing a crash on OSX.

Show diffs side-by-side

added added

removed removed

Lines of Context:
103
103
#      multiple-row statement, the preceding rows will have been inserted.
104
104
#
105
105
create table bug20691 (i int, d datetime NOT NULL, dn datetime NULL);
106
 
--error ER_NO_DEFAULT_FOR_FIELD
 
106
--error 1364
107
107
insert into bug20691 values (7, DEFAULT, DEFAULT), (7, '1975-07-10 07:10:03', '1978-01-13 14:08:51'), (7, DEFAULT, DEFAULT);
108
108
insert into bug20691 values (7, '1975-07-10 07:10:03', DEFAULT);
109
109
select * from bug20691 order by i asc;
118
118
  i decimal not null,
119
119
  x int);
120
120
insert into bug20691 values (3, '0007-01-01', 11, 17, '0019-01-01 00:00:00', 23, 1);
121
 
--error ER_NO_DEFAULT_FOR_FIELD
 
121
--error 1364
122
122
insert into bug20691 (x) values (2);
123
123
insert into bug20691 values (3, '0007-01-01', 11, 17, '0019-01-01 00:00:00', 23, 3);
124
 
--error ER_NO_DEFAULT_FOR_FIELD
 
124
--error 1364
125
125
insert into bug20691 values (DEFAULT, DEFAULT, DEFAULT, DEFAULT, DEFAULT, DEFAULT, 4);
126
126
select * from bug20691 order by x asc;
127
127
drop table bug20691;